Bits & Pieces: Personal Holiness (7)

"As obedient children, do not be conformed to the former lusts which were yours in your ignorance, but like the Holy One who called you, be holy yourselves also in all your behavior; because it is written, 'YOU SHALL BE HOLY, FOR I AM HOLY," (I Peter 1:14--16).

* When one is called by the Holy Spirit to salvation in the Lord Jesus, he is called to holiness. A willingness and a determination to forsake any and all worldly priorities characterizes the attitude of the true Christian. How it must grieve the Holy One who called us to see so many trying to cling to pagan practices while claiming His Name.

* As every genuine believer can testify, each and every day we are continually tugged at by the world, the flesh, and the devil, to compromise the standard of holiness to which we've been called. But if our witness is watered down by accommodating to the world's ways, where will be the holy boldness required to confront our society? How can we denounce the rank paganism of our day, if it is approved and encouraged in our families, churches, and denominations?
